U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P) announces the availability of a Final Environmental Assessment (EA) and associated Finding of No Significant Impact (FONSI) which analyzes the potential environmental impacts of the replacement of the pier and boat ramp in Ponce, Puerto Rico.
The Draft EA was made available for a 30-day public review and comment period between October 31 and November 30, 2018. It was accessible through CBP.gov and by distribution to stakeholders and a local public library. The notice of availability for the draft was published in the La Perla del Sur newspaper on October 31 and November 7, 2018.
Based on the findings of the EA, and after careful review of the potential environmental impacts of implementing the proposed action, CBP finds there would be no significant impact on the quality of the human or natural environment, either individually or cumulatively. Therefore, preparation of an environmental impact statement is not required and a FONSI has been issued.
